#ECB25F Color
#ECB25F is rgb(236, 178, 95) in RGB, hsl(35, 79%, 65%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 25%, 60%, 7%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Sunray (#E3AB57),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 2.84.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#ECB25F Channel Values
How #ECB25F bre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 236 · G 178 · B 95 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 35° · S 79% · L 65%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 35° · S 60% · V 93%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 25% · Y 60% · K 7%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.89:1 vs white · 11.1: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#ECB25F background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#ECB25F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#ECB25F?
#ECB25F is a light orange — rgb(236, 178, 95) in RGB and hsl(35, 79%, 65%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Sunray (#E3AB57),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 2.84.
What is the RGB value of #ECB25F?
#ECB25F is rgb(236, 178, 95) — red 236, green 178, and blue 95 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#ECB25F?
#ECB25F conver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 25%, 60%, 7%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#ECB25F be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#ECB25F scores 1.89:1 against white and 11.1: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#ECB25F as a CSS color keyword?
No. #ECB25F is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is sandybrown (#F4A460) at a CIE76 distance of 11, which is visibly different.
